Method: accounts.products.update

Chèn hoặc cập nhật các thuộc tính của sản phẩm trong tài khoản Manufacturer Center.

Tạo một sản phẩm có các thuộc tính bạn đã cung cấp. Nếu sản phẩm đã tồn tại thì tất cả các thuộc tính sẽ được thay thế bằng các thuộc tính mới. Các bước kiểm tra tại thời điểm tải lên rất đơn giản. Sản phẩm phải có tất cả các thuộc tính bắt buộc thì mới hợp lệ. Các vấn đề có thể xuất hiện vào lúc khác sau khi API chấp nhận một sản phẩm mới được tải lên và bạn có thể thay thế một sản phẩm hợp lệ hiện có bằng một sản phẩm không hợp lệ. Để phát hiện vấn đề này, bạn nên truy xuất sản phẩm và kiểm tra vấn đề sau khi có phiên bản mới.

Trước tiên, bạn cần phải xử lý các thuộc tính đã tải lên rồi mới có thể truy xuất các thuộc tính đó. Cho đến lúc đó, sản phẩm mới sẽ không có sẵn và việc truy xuất các sản phẩm đã tải lên trước đó sẽ trả về trạng thái ban đầu của sản phẩm.

Yêu cầu HTTP

PUT https://manufacturers.googleapis.com/v1/{parent=accounts/*}/products/{name}

URL sử dụng cú pháp Chuyển mã gRPC.

Tham số đường dẫn

Thông số
parent

string

Mã nhận dạng mẹ ở định dạng accounts/{account_id}.

account_id – Mã nhận dạng của tài khoản Manufacturer Center.

name

string

Tên ở định dạng {targetCountry}:{contentLanguage}:{productId}.

targetCountry – Quốc gia mục tiêu của sản phẩm dưới dạng mã lãnh thổ CLDR (ví dụ: Hoa Kỳ).

contentLanguage – Ngôn ngữ nội dung của sản phẩm dưới dạng mã ngôn ngữ gồm hai chữ cái theo ISO 639-1 (ví dụ: en).

productId – Mã sản phẩm. Để biết thêm thông tin, hãy xem https://support.google.com/manufacturers/answer/6124116#id.

Nội dung yêu cầu

Nội dung yêu cầu chứa một bản sao của Attributes.

Nội dung phản hồi

Nếu thành công, nội dung phản hồi sẽ trống.

Phạm vi uỷ quyền

Yêu cầu phạm vi OAuth sau:

  • https://www.googleapis.com/auth/manufacturercenter

Để biết thêm thông tin, hãy xem bài viết Tổng quan về OAuth 2.0.